Blowing hot and blowing cold - Duet in heaven
I am sharing the picture of my outing yesterday to a temple in South India. This place is perennially hot AND dry. I think the temperature was 90 F. But, having a cool undertone helps a lot. That's why I chose to go with a dark top piece and beige chinos in two outfits. In one case, I wore an orange Tee and in another a brown polo. I am attaching two pictures one for each combination. The common item in both pictures is the beige trucker jacket. The image in the temple is without shoes (footwear is not allowed inside). What is fascinating is my use of a jacket that was pretty "cool." I managed to make multiple heads turn 😀. Contrary to "common" belief, one can easily layer up in hot weather as long as the fabrics allow you to (and the bonus is having a cool undertone 😎). Here is what I wore: THE TOP: Brown polo (1) and orange t-shirt - both 100% suplma cotton. THE BOTTOM: Beige MTM chinos. THE LAYER: Beige tucker jacket (100% cotton in twill weave). THE BELT: Brown and black reversible. THE SHOES: Tan moccasins in nubuck leather THE WATCH: Tan strap with gold-on-steel frame. Your feedback is most welcome!
